Stashnyi

21147
Nominal Guns14RWAS
NationalityRussia
OperatorBaltic Sea Fleet
Keel Laid Down3.12.1786RWAS
Launched8.5.1788RWAS
How acquiredPurpose builtRWAS
ShipyardSaint Petersburg - Russia RWAS
Constructor
S. DurakinRussian
Ship Builder
RWAS
CategoryUnratedRWAS
Ship TypeBomb VesselRWAS
Broken Up1794RWAS

Dimensions


DimensionMeasurementTypeMetric EquivalentRWAS
Length of Gundeck95' 0"Imperial Feet28.956 
Breadth27' 0"Imperial Feet8.2296 
Depth in Hold11' 0"Imperial Feet3.3528 

Service History


DateEventSource
17.7.1788Battle of Hogland
26.7.17892nd Battle of Oland
13.5.1790Battle of Reval
4.7.1790Battle of Viborg
1791Stationed in Kronshtadt roads until 1794RWAS
